Title
Japanese Lacquered Box
Description
Black Japanese box completely lacquered, inside and out, with removable lid (b) and two drawers (c,d) with metal handles that swivel 180 degrees. Top drawer is shallow, bottom drawer is deep. The rounded top front is painted with fine gold pattern, surrounded by gold border.
Various feathers painted on sides. All edges are painted gold. 3 birds painted on top with fine gold lines crossing at angles to create a mesh pattern.
Missing piece out of top part on side.
a. 100 stiff paper cards with a single black shadowed letter on one side of each card for each of the 26 letters of the English alphabet.

Title
Buchanan Japanese First Embassy Medal
Description
a.(medal): Circular bronzed copper commemorative medal. Raised profile of James Buchanan in center. Around edge:"James Buchanan, President of the United States." Beneath is name of the designer, "S.(alathiel) Ellis. SC."
On reverse: Border of 3 layers of oak leaves and acorns with a striped shield at bottom center. In center above: " In/Commemoration/of the/ First Embassy from/ Japan/to the/ United States/ 1860" On right, beneath striped shield: "Paquet F."
b. Leather case for Buchanan Commemorative medal in the shape of a large coin. On both black leather covers and spine is a gold 3-line border that frames an eagle perched on a striped shield with arrows and olive branches beneath its clawed foot. 13 gold stars surround it and sprays of peonies are in each corner. The book opens to the back. Wood edges frame a circular holder for the medal. Peony sprays are pressed into all 4 corners of the velvet covering.
Commemorates the Japanese Delegation visit to United States of America
